Description

Decadrachm from Syracuse. Issued in 278. Struck in Gold. Measures 16 mm and weighs 4.25 g.

Obverse
Head of Persephone to left, wearing wreath of grain leaves, pendant earring and pearl necklace. Behind neck, bee
Reverse
Nike, holding goad in her right hand and reins in her left driving biga galloping to right. Below, Θ, above, earring and in exergue, inscription
